1. Preamble
In this course on Multi-Agent Programming, the focus is on the practical programming of Multi-Agent Systems. It addresses approaches for developing complex systems and approaches for simulating such systems.
Dealing with the development of complex systems, this course presents two main lines of use of the multi-agent paradigm for developing complex systems: Multi-Agent Based Simulation (MABS) for the simulation of complex systems and Multi-Agent Oriented Programming (MAOP) used for the integration of intelligent systems and development of socio-technical systems. Besides learning foundations and state of the art works done on this topic in the Multi-Agent domain, you will learn how to take a MAOP approach for developing Decentralized and Open AI systems.
2. Multi-Agent Oriented Programming
The Multi-Agent Oriented Programming approach consists in a composition of Agent models, Environment models and Organisation models, interacting all together. Each of these models are built by picking concepts in, respectively, the Agent, Environment or Organisation dimension. Using MAOP by privileging each of these dimensions may respectively lead to Agent Oriented Programming (AOP), Environment Oriented Programming (EOP) and Organization Oriented Programming (OOP).
We use the JaCaMo
platform for the practical exercises that are presented in this course. This programming platform results from the integration of the Jason Agent Programming Language supporting the JaCaMo
agent dimension, CArTaGo Environment Programming platform supporting the JaCaMo
environment dimension and MOISE Organization programming platform supporting the JaCaMo
organisation dimension.
